2. Fuller’s Earth
Fuller’s earth is also a beneficial ingredient in dealing with clogged pores.
It acts like a sponge that can draw out the substances that add up to clogged pores.
Plus, fuller’s earth has been using for oily skin for ages thanks to its high concentration of antioxidants and anti-inflammatory ingredients.
3. Sugar
Sugar is such a wonderful natural exfoliating agent that can help break up scar tissue and unclog skin pores, giving you a helping hand in dealing with the problems of clogged pores.
- Have two teaspoons sugar mixed with an equal amount of lemon.
- You can add some honey into it to prevent dry skin.
- Rub all over your face and wait for a while.
- Wash off with water after that.
4. Steam
Steaming your face is another alternative to open and clean your pores by removing impurities trapped inside.
To make the most of steam, some people apply this before using a face mask.
Besides, this is also wonderful therapy you can do at home to reduce stress and keep your skin at its best and glowing all the time.
